Essential Functions:

Represent Pinkerton’s core values of integrity, vigilance, and excellence.

Monitor publicly available open sources using proprietary systems to provide a 24/7 tactical intelligence picture.

Monitor geopolitical and weather events that may impact business travel and company events.

Produce intelligence products to enhance situational awareness and operational readiness, such as flash reports, daily reports, situational reports, verbal briefs, event and travel security assessments. Longer-term products may include working with Intelligence teams on assessments to facilitate the decision-making of

cross-functional teams

.

Coordinate travel security logistical support through providers.

Escalate to GSOC

leadership

and crisis management teams during incidents and crisis events.

Conduct check-ins on staff and offices during incidents and crisis events, tally responses, and provide regular updates to crisis management teams.

Support intrusion alarm escalation protocols by attending to calls from alarm monitoring vendors and activating appropriate security response when necessary.

All other duties, as assigned.
